The basis for the parallel society was born in the mind of Ivan Yerus, a Czech poet and artistic director of the rock band The Plastic People of the Universe. After members of this band were arrested in 1976 for refusing to tow the government line, Yerus called on the community of Czech artists to create music labels, publishing houses, concert halls, art expositions. He hypothesized that if enough infrastructure were created, an independent society would spontaneously form - functioning as a pocket of creative freedom in a highly oppressed society.
